Race-day runbook — Chipstride reader fleet. Before the Harlow Bay Marathon start, power up each mat reader and confirm it registers with the Splitline aggregator (green heartbeat in the tent console). If a reader shows amber, it's almost always the env file on its companion box — the flash step sometimes wipes it. Restore READER_ID and AGGREGATOR_HOST from the printed sheet, then re-add the one entry we never print. The aggregator auth credential goes on the following line.

env line for fafof-fahag: LEDGER_TOKEN5=f8790

## Approvals: Tilefetch Prefetcher

The Tilefetch map-tile prefetcher is ready for rollout. Cache-hit rate up 40% in staging; bandwidth caps verified. Remaining step: a single approval under the standard change process before Thursday's deploy. No open blockers. Raise objections at the sync or hold your peace. The approver of record is listed below.

signatory, kafop-bahaf: Lamion Queniel Jorir Olidor

Handover — Log Sampling for Perchline

Perchline emits roughly 40k lines per minute, mostly heartbeat noise. We sample debug-level logs at 1% and keep warnings and above in full. Sampling happens in the collector sidecar, not the app, so redeploying Perchline won't change rates. If storage costs spike, check for new unsampled loggers first. The sampler currently runs with these settings.

settings of tajep-tafog:
CASDOR_LOG_LEVEL=info
CASDOR_METRICS_HOST=metrics.casdor.nelvrosys.internal
CASDOR_POOL_SIZE=16

☐ Step 7 — Before merging the Tarnwick dedup index keys, confirm both custodians from the Halverlea site have witnessed the sealing of the customer-record match tables. Record the seal timestamp in the ceremony ledger and verify the fingerprint aloud. Do not proceed to key escrow until done. Escrow access requires the recovery passphrase below.

vault phrase of taweg-kafof = oliax-zorael

Partner drop, step 3. The Tillamook feed is delivered nightly to the Brindle SFTP endpoint; our exporter uploads the reconciled ledger at 02:00 local. Reviewers should confirm the exporter pins the host fingerprint and refuses fallback ciphers — this has regressed twice. Connections authenticate via a dedicated deploy credential, never a personal account. The current deploy key is below.

rollout seal: bky4_DFM9